By Cyrille Chavet, Philippe Coussy
This e-book offers thorough assurance of errors correcting recommendations. It comprises crucial uncomplicated thoughts and the most recent advances on key themes in layout, implementation, and optimization of hardware/software structures for blunders correction. The book’s chapters are written via across the world well-known specialists during this box. themes contain evolution of errors correction thoughts, business person wishes, architectures, and layout methods for the main complex errors correcting codes (Polar Codes, Non-Binary LDPC, Product Codes, etc). This e-book offers entry to fresh effects, and is appropriate for graduate scholars and researchers of arithmetic, laptop technological know-how, and engineering.
• Examines find out how to optimize the structure of layout for mistakes correcting codes;
• provides blunders correction codes from thought to optimized structure for the present and the subsequent iteration standards;
• presents insurance of business person wishes complex errors correcting techniques.
Advanced layout for mistakes Correcting Codes incorporates a foreword via Claude Berrou.
Read or Download Advanced Hardware Design for Error Correcting Codes PDF
Best data processing books
Machine algebra platforms at the moment are ubiquitous in all components of technological know-how and engineering. This hugely winning textbook, extensively considered as the 'bible of laptop algebra', provides a radical creation to the algorithmic foundation of the mathematical engine in desktop algebra structures. Designed to accompany one- or two-semester classes for complex undergraduate or graduate scholars in laptop technological know-how or arithmetic, its comprehensiveness and reliability has additionally made it a necessary reference for execs within the sector.
This e-book experiences social phenomena in a brand new manner, via making sensible use of computing device expertise. The ebook addresses the total spectrum of vintage stories in social technology, from experiments to the computational types, with a multidisciplinary method. The e-book is appropriate if you are looking to get an image of what it capability to do social study at the present time, and likewise to get a sign of the most important open concerns.
This ebook indicates the is a step by step exercise-driven advisor for college students and practitioners who have to grasp Excel to unravel sensible technology difficulties. If knowing records isn’t your most powerful go well with, you're not in particular mathematically-inclined, or while you are cautious of desktops, this can be the suitable booklet for you.
The net of items, cloud computing, hooked up cars, vast info, analytics — what does this need to do with the automobile undefined? This publication offers information regarding the way forward for mobility traits because of digitisation, connectedness, personalisation and information insights. The automobile is at the verge of present process a primary transformation.
- Systems Approaches to Managing Change: A Practical Guide
- Pro Salesforce Analytics Cloud: A Guide to Wave Platform, Builder, and Explorer
- Business Intelligence-Grundlagen und praktische Anwendungen: Eine Einführung in die IT-basierte Managementunterstützung
- Categorical data analysis using the SAS system
Additional resources for Advanced Hardware Design for Error Correcting Codes
Chavet, P. 1007/978-3-319-10569-7__3 33 34 G. J. Gross b u0 + v1 u1 a u0 u1 + W y0 W y1 u2 u3 v0 + + + x0 x1 v2 x2 v3 x3 W y0 W y1 W y2 W y3 Fig. 1 Construction of polar codes of lengths 2 and 4, where ⊕ is the XOR operator. 2) and λu1 = g(λv0 , λv1 , uˆ0 ) = λv0 + λv1 when uˆ0 = 0, − λv0 + λv1 when uˆ0 = 1 . 3) λv0 and λv1 correspond to inputs and are replaced with y in the last stage of the recursive decoding. The recursive approach to the algorithm is not suitable for a hardware implementation.
Later works have shown polar codes achieve the symmetric capacity of any memoryless channel [2, 3]. A polar code of length N and dimension k is constructed by placing the information bits in the k most reliable locations in the vector u0N−1 and setting the remaining bits, known as the frozen bits, to predetermined values, usually 0. 2 Successive-Cancellation Decoding Successive cancellation (SC) is the canonical algorithm for decoding polar codes and is the one used when proving their capacity-achieving performance in .
Where before data have iteratively been exchanged between VNs and CNs, now all data flow in one direction. Each iteration has a dedicated hardware unit and thus the decoder’s overall area scales linear with the 26 N. Wehn et al. number of decoding iterations. The result is an unidirectional wiring avoiding the overlap of opposed networks. This is a big benefit for the routing and makes the architecture more area efficient than state-of-the-art decoders which is shown in Sect. 4. The control flow of the proposed architecture is reduced to a minimum.